THE GREATEST GUIDE TO WHAT IS MD5'S APPLICATION

The Greatest Guide To what is md5's application

The Greatest Guide To what is md5's application

Blog Article

This information will examine the variances in between MD5 and SHA for password hashing, outlining their respective strengths and weaknesses, and explaining why just one is usually preferred about another in fashionable cryptographic procedures.

LinkedIn Facts Breach (2012): In a single of the largest info breaches, hackers stole and posted an incredible number of LinkedIn user passwords, which ended up hashed making use of unsalted MD5. This led into the publicity of numerous consumer accounts.

MD5 is a cryptographic hash purpose, that has a lot of pros such as the velocity to create them plus the Nearly irreversible algorithm. These have leaded the MD5 algorithm being widely used before, but where by is this perform still utilised nowadays?

These hashing features not simply give superior safety and also consist of functions like salting and critical stretching to further more improve password safety.

- Even a small change from the input brings about a completely unique hash because of the avalanche outcome.

In contrast, SHA—particularly the SHA-256 and SHA-512 variants—presents more powerful stability and is also a better selection for cryptographic applications, Even though even It is far from exclusively designed for password hashing.

The birthday assault exploits the birthday paradox to seek out collisions in hash capabilities far more efficiently. MD5’s 128-bit duration causes it to be vulnerable to these assaults, as the chances of finding a collision enhance considerably as additional hashes are generated.

Now that We've got our output from this primary modular addition box, it’s time to maneuver on. If you follow the line leaving the box, you will notice that it factors to a different of the exact same modular addition packing containers.

The main strengths of this algorithm in comparison with other Option is definitely the native assistance on any working technique plus the velocity to deliver a MD5 hash. It received’t slow any procedure, so it’s ideal to implement it Despite having large dataset.

Just like every little thing that desktops do, this occurs for the binary level, and it will be much easier for us to see what’s occurring if we temporarily change our click here hexadecimal selection back into binary.

Within this website, we’ll dive into why MD5 is not the hero it when was, the risks it poses, and what’s taken its location. We’ll also chat about sensible strategies for retaining your information Protected and how to move away from MD5 in more mature units.

Knowledge Breach Chance: If a legacy technique with MD5 is compromised, sensitive information may be uncovered, resulting in info breaches and reputational destruction.

This process would continue right until most of the First input has been processed, Irrespective of how quite a few 512-bit blocks it takes. Any time it concerns the last block, the algorithm would follow the procedure outlined inside the The final action, right after 64 functions segment, ultimately providing us new values to get a, B, C and D. These would then be concatenated to variety the hash.

A industry of cryptography aiming to establish algorithms protected against quantum computing attacks, which could render present algorithms like MD5 obsolete.

Report this page